Tour Overview
Embark on a captivating journey through Coastal New England, exploring iconic cities and historic sites across the USA. Begin with a city tour of New York City, where you'll marvel at landmarks like the Empire State Building, Rockefeller Center, Wall Street, and Times Square. Travel north through Connecticut, pausing at the charming seaport village of Mystic. Discover Newport, the "sailing capital of the world," with its breathtaking Ten Mile Drive and opulent Gilded Age mansions. Delve into maritime history at New Bedford's Whaling National Historical Park, and explore the historic fishing port of Provincetown on Cape Cod, where you can enjoy local seafood and browse vibrant shops and galleries. Conclude your adventure with a city tour of Boston, visiting iconic sites such as the Old State House and the Freedom Trail, and savor a delightful lunch at Quincy Market. This tour offers a perfect blend of history, culture, and stunning coastal views. ...more ...less

Day 4: Middletown. Day Trip To Newport,Ri
Location: Newport, The Breakers
Accommodation Name: Sonesta Select Newport Middletown
Travel to nearby Newport, known as the “sailing capital of the world.” Enjoy the Ten Mile Drive where you’ll have spectacular ocean views and pass by gorgeous Gilded Age mansions. Afterwards, have free time to explore the thriving harbor and historic Old Quarter which includes the country’s largest collection of colonial houses. Or take a step back in time to America’s Gilded Age with an optional excursion to The Breakers, the 70-room crown jewel of the Newport Mansions and summer home of Cornelius Vanderbilt II.

Day 7: Plymouth,Boston,Ma
Location: Boston, Old State House, Freedom Trail, Old North Church, Faneuil Hall, Quincy Market, North End
Accommodation Name: Aloft Boston Seaport District
Take a city tour of Boston, the largest city in New England and a city of firsts. The first public school, first public transit system, first municipal library, first public park and more. See historic sites like the Old State House, the Freedom Trail and the Old North Church, where Paul Revere got the signal to start his famous ride. Stop by Faneuil Hall and have lunch in Quincy Market, perhaps trying some Boston Baked Beans or a bowl of New England Clam Chowder then have the rest of the day at leisure to discover this city full of history, culture, sports, and good food! Speaking of which, get a true taste of Italian Cuisine this evening at an optional dinner in Boston’s North End, also known as Little Italy.
